





Fernando Samalot
Fernando Samalot is a photographer and poet from Puerto Rico offering his art as a pathway to healing and transformation.
His work explores themes such as the relationship between light and darkness, vulnerability, trust, surrender, sensuality and softness- allowing space to honor all the different aspects that shape us into multi dimensional beings.
Known for his use of vibrant colors, a dreamlike natural light and interweaving bodies with landscapes, he opens up his hidden world in hopes of creating connection and allowing the viewer to tap into something deeper in themselves.
